fre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

c第六章習(xí)題解答(存儲(chǔ)版)

  

【正文】 } coutendl。 int i。ih。 coutiendl。 int last。 // 無(wú)關(guān)成員函數(shù)省略,缺省的=等不必定義}。 //未交換標(biāo)志為真 for(j=0。 }}int main(){ const int h=8。 for(i=0。 return 0。public: Orderedlist(){last=1。)。i){//從上往下冒泡,? noswap=true。 //本趟無(wú)交換,則終止算法。} else {slist[k]=[j]。 } while(j=) {//復(fù)制第二個(gè)表的剩余元素 slist[k]=[j]。 char sp1[h][10]={南京大學(xué),東南大學(xué),交通大學(xué),清華大學(xué),天津大學(xué),復(fù)旦大學(xué),浙江大學(xué),同濟(jì)大學(xué)}。 ()。 for(i=0。 (ordlist1,ordlist2)。參見(jiàn)下圖:全部采用函數(shù)模板,包括希爾插入子程序。public: int getlast(){return last。 void Shellsort()。 last++。\t39。 for(i=gap。tempslist[jgap]){//升序 slist[j]=slist[jgap]。 for(i=0。 ()。 T slist[size]。 void print()。 last++。\t39。 T temp。 while(j=gapamp。 string n[h]。 //建立順序表 cout未排序表:endl。}。ih。 int i。 temp=(i)。 }}//int size必須保留template typename T,int size void Shellinsert(OrderedlistT,size amp。 if(i%5==4) coutendl。j) slist[j]=slist[j1]。} bool Insert(T amp。template typename T,int sizeclass Orderedlist{ int maxsize。 //建立順序表 cout未排序表:endl。 string n[h]。 while(j=gapamp。 T temp。 if(i%5==4) coutendl。j) slist[j]=slist[j1]。 elem,int i)。 T slist[size]。再取gap=gap/2,則分組成為L(zhǎng)[0],L[gap],L[2gap],……為一組,L[1],L[gap+1],L[2gap+1],……為一組,等等,分別進(jìn)行插入排序。 cout已排序表:endl。ih2。i++) (n[i],i)。 Orderedliststring,h ordlist,ordlist1,ordlist2。 k++。(j=)){ if([i][j]) {slist[k]=[i]。 noswap=false。 for (i=last。 void Merge(Orderedlist amp。 int last。 cout已排序表:endl。ih。 } } if(noswap) break。i0。 elem,int i)。includeiostreamincludestringusing namespace std。 coutiendl。i++) n[i]=sp[i]。 } return mid。 //打印5個(gè)名稱換行 else cout39。j) slist[j]=slist[j1]。 void print()。 T slist[size]。 coutiendl。 mystring ms[6],x=交通大學(xué),y=南京大學(xué)。 x,int size){//獨(dú)立的函數(shù)模板 int high=size1 ,low=0,mid。i++) ms[i].show()。 char sp[6][10]={南京大學(xué),東南大學(xué),交通大學(xué),清華大學(xué),天津大學(xué),復(fù)旦大學(xué)}。i!=) return true。 }while(k==0amp。 str[last]=[last]。lastmaxsize1)。mystring amp。 } mystring amp。 ms){ last=1。\039。 str[0]=39。解:使用獨(dú)立的函數(shù)模板,相對(duì)簡(jiǎn)單。pa是指向數(shù)組的指針,該數(shù)組的元素均為函數(shù)指針,所指向的函數(shù)無(wú)參、返回值是指向Node類的指針。否則先移的數(shù)據(jù)會(huì)沖掉未移的數(shù)據(jù)。如數(shù)組類模板,可以有一個(gè)數(shù)組長(zhǎng)度的非類型參數(shù)。函數(shù)模板可以用來(lái)創(chuàng)建一個(gè)通用功能的函數(shù),以支持多種不同形參,簡(jiǎn)化重載函數(shù)的設(shè)計(jì)。 什么叫函數(shù)模板?什么叫模板函數(shù)?什么叫類模板?什么叫模板類?答:不受數(shù)據(jù)類型限制的通用型的函數(shù)使代碼的可重用性大大提高。答案:(1)無(wú)序的(所有)(2)有序的 最常見(jiàn)的排序方式有 (1) 、 (2) 和 (3) 。答案:(1)模板實(shí)參推演(template argument deduction)(2)一組實(shí)際類型或(和)值 順序查找可以用于 (1) 線性表,而對(duì)半查找可以用于 (2) 線性表。也可以用一維數(shù)組加各維的大小都作為參數(shù)傳遞。模板類型參數(shù)代表一種潛在的內(nèi)置或用戶定義的類型,由關(guān)鍵字typename或class后加一個(gè)標(biāo)識(shí)符構(gòu)成。模板非類型參數(shù)表示該參數(shù)名代表了一個(gè)潛在的常量。關(guān)鍵是后移時(shí)從最后一個(gè)元素開(kāi)始。fa是有一個(gè)整型參數(shù)的函數(shù),其返回值是指針,該指針是指向無(wú)參函數(shù)的指針,而該無(wú)參函數(shù)的返回值是指向Node類的指針。這是面向過(guò)程的方法。 maxsize=n。 }while(s[last]!=39。 } mystring(mystring amp。 } void show(){//如需重載,暫時(shí)未學(xué)到,替代方法是改用show()函數(shù) coutstrendl。}。amp。 do{ last++。 i++。amp。}int main(){ i
點(diǎn)擊復(fù)制文檔內(nèi)容
試題試卷相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1